Abstract
The main characteristic of Hermite elements is that they include both the nodal values and their tangential derivatives in the functional representation of the field variables. In the present work, this feature is exploited to obtain an inexpensive and reliable error indicator, based on the tangential derivatives of the field variables rather than the field variables themselves. This new error indicator is developed, together with an h-adaptive strategy, in the context of Laplaceʹs equation. The numerical implementation shows satisfactory and very promising results.
